Description
Ideal for both the primary care practitioner and the medical student, this handy pocket manual presents step-by-step guidelines on patient workup, differential diagnosis, and therapy for more than 40 symptoms occurring in the head and neck. Coverage of special topics include pediatric, adolescent, and geriatric otolaryngology, plus an introduction to outcome analysis and office-based clinical research.
